Once upon a time, a hare went to a pool to drink water. By chance, he noticed a slow-moving tortoise nearby and couldn’t resist mocking him. Feeling insulted, the tortoise challenged the hare to a race.

The hare, confident of his speed, accepted the challenge with a smirk. The next morning, they both gathered at the starting point, and the race began.

As expected, the hare sped far ahead and soon left the tortoise behind. After covering most of the distance, the hare grew bored and decided to rest, seeing the tortoise far behind. He nibbled on some grass, then lay under a shady bush and fell asleep.

Meanwhile, the tortoise kept moving steadily, step by step, never stopping. Eventually, he passed the sleeping hare and reached the finish line.

When the hare woke up, he realized he had slept for too long. Panicking, he ran as fast as he could toward the destination. But to his dismay, he found the tortoise already there, victorious.

Moral: Slow and steady wins the race.
